[Glamor] about glamor Xv support
bradpitt
hechuanbear at qq.com
Mon Apr 29 06:57:58 PDT 2013
I'm a master student from Peking University. I want to apply for this project, however I have a few questions about it so far.
1. I haven't any Xv driver implementation in glamor source code. Do I need to add a Xv driver(eg. glamor_video.c) first?
2. The basic goal is to implement colorspace conversions for various YUV formats. You want me to use GPU to transfrom YUV to RGB?
3. Advanced goals. Improved scaling algorithms: I find some ddx drivers do this by calling xf86clipvideohelper, Do you want to use openGL to accelerate it?
4. and the rest: Support for brightness/contrast/saturation/hue adjustments;Support for gamma adjustment;Support for colorspace selection. I think it's quite easy to do it using CPU. And I have done this using hardware other than GPU. I suppose you want me to use GLSL to do it?
In summary, I need some specific details about your requirement since I'm not quite familiar with glamor project. But I'm involved in developing a ddx driver using GPU through EXA to accelerate 2d render in our lab, so I'm very excited when I see this project, maybe I can learn a lot from it.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freedesktop.org/archives/glamor/attachments/20130429/3c915830/attachment.html>
More information about the Glamor
mailing list